The role of a Restaurant Manager at Olive Garden is critical to its operational success and customer satisfaction. Reporting directly to the General Manager, Restaurant Managers are entrusted with leading their teams effectively, ensuring that service standards exceed guest expectations, and maintaining a high level of operational excellence. This position is designed for individuals who are proactive, results-driven, and passionate about creating memorable dining experiences through exceptional leadership and teamwork. Managers can expect to work no more than 50 hours per week, enjoy two days off, and have at least one weekend off per month, supporting a healthy work-life balance.
In addition to competitive base salary and quarterly bonuses, Restaurant Managers have immediate eligibility for medical, dental, and vision insurance, along with company-paid short-term disability and life insurance. Olive Garden supports its restaurant managers through comprehensive career advancement pathways, robust training programs, and tuition reimbursement options, reflecting the company’s commitment to internal promotion—99% of General Managers and Directors of Operations were promoted from within. Managers also benefit from flexible paid time off, including vacation, flex time, maternity and paternity leave, and adoption reimbursement assistance.
